IP查询
查询
你查询的IP:[59.32.2.220] 地理位置:中国–广东–河源
最新查询
121.224.84.0
218.240.14.181
119.32.27.146
221.200.56.1
219.224.189.63
119.50.251.168
222.168.69.242
119.40.33.149
221.208.137.120
59.32.2.220
203.128.96.16
122.51.194.19
221.12.152.135
122.224.202.58
121.59.213.3
202.70.117.124
122.156.136.33
125.171.50.247
118.230.108.59
116.214.64.85
58.82.205.157
210.5.144.37
123.98.240.155
120.92.140.72
202.69.16.56
203.91.120.158
210.16.128.41
202.38.64.121
202.112.38.34
123.49.128.224
203.128.96.105